[PDF] Refactor SkPDFFont to enable font/cmap subsetting.

+#ifndef SkPDFFontImpl_DEFINED
+#define SkPDFFontImpl_DEFINED
+
+#include "SkPDFFont.h"
+
+class SkPDFType0Font : public SkPDFFont {
+public:
+    virtual ~SkPDFType0Font();
+    virtual bool multiByteGlyphs() const { return true; }
+    SK_API virtual SkPDFFont* getFontSubset(const SkPDFGlyphSet* usage);
+#ifdef SK_DEBUG
+    virtual void emitObject(SkWStream* stream, SkPDFCatalog* catalog,
+                            bool indirect);
+#endif
+
+private:
+    friend class SkPDFFont;  // to access the constructor
+#ifdef SK_DEBUG
+    bool fPopulated;
+    typedef SkPDFDict INHERITED;
+#endif
+
+    SkPDFType0Font(SkAdvancedTypefaceMetrics* info, SkTypeface* typeface);
+
+    bool populate(const SkPDFGlyphSet* subset);
+};
+
+class SkPDFCIDFont : public SkPDFFont {
+public:
+    virtual ~SkPDFCIDFont();
+    virtual bool multiByteGlyphs() const { return true; }
+
+private:
+    friend class SkPDFType0Font;  // to access the constructor
+
+    SkPDFCIDFont(SkAdvancedTypefaceMetrics* info, SkTypeface* typeface,
+                 const SkPDFGlyphSet* subset);
+
+    bool populate(const SkPDFGlyphSet* subset);
+    bool addFontDescriptor(int16_t defaultWidth, const SkPDFGlyphSet* subset);
+};
+
+class SkPDFType1Font : public SkPDFFont {
+public:
+    virtual ~SkPDFType1Font();
+    virtual bool multiByteGlyphs() const { return false; }
+
+private:
+    friend class SkPDFFont;  // to access the constructor
+
+    SkPDFType1Font(SkAdvancedTypefaceMetrics* info, SkTypeface* typeface,
+                   uint16_t glyphID, SkPDFDict* relatedFontDescriptor);
+
+    bool populate(int16_t glyphID);
+    bool addFontDescriptor(int16_t defaultWidth);
+    void addWidthInfoFromRange(int16_t defaultWidth,
+        const SkAdvancedTypefaceMetrics::WidthRange* widthRangeEntry);
+};
+
+class SkPDFType3Font : public SkPDFFont {
+public:
+    virtual ~SkPDFType3Font();
+    virtual bool multiByteGlyphs() const { return false; }
+
+private:
+    friend class SkPDFFont;  // to access the constructor
+
+    SkPDFType3Font(SkAdvancedTypefaceMetrics* info, SkTypeface* typeface,
+                   uint16_t glyphID, SkPDFDict* relatedFontDescriptor);
+
+    bool populate(int16_t glyphID);
+};
+
+#endif
